nmi = mi × 0.868976Consumer GPS units and road signage report distance in statute miles, but flight plans, marine charts, and air traffic control all work in nautical miles. Anyone bridging the two, a boater checking a GPS-reported distance against a paper chart, or a pilot cross-referencing airport data, needs this conversion.

Real-World Examples
A boater's handheld GPS shows 100 miles to the next marina. Converted to 86.9 nautical miles, that matches the distance marked on the paper nautical chart.
100 mi = 86.9 nmi
Air traffic control requires 3 statute miles of separation in some airspace; a pilot converts that to 2.6 nautical miles to cross-check against onboard instruments calibrated in nautical units.
3 mi = 2.6069 nmi
A sailing race course is described as 25 miles by the event's public website; competitors convert to 21.7 nautical miles to plan fuel and time using standard marine navigation math.
25 mi = 21.72 nmi
A private pilot's road-trip-style range estimate of 500 miles becomes 434.5 nautical miles when entered into flight-planning software.
500 mi = 434.49 nmi
